Cops from Nuneaton will take on firefighters from Coventry in a fundraising football match. It will be held on Saturday, May 18 with a 13:00 KO. The match has been organised by PC Lloyd Walton and Rich Stanton, who is a group commander for West Midlands Fire Station.
Both are close friends of Matt Hall who, together with his wife Paula, set up the charity Georgie's Gift as a legacy to their 'little princess' Georgie who sadly lost her young life to meningitis.
"We would like to say a big thank you to the Boro' for supporting the charity," PC Walton said. "It should be a good match, it is free entry but donations are welcomed and the bar will be open."
Nuneaton Borough Commercial Manager Mark Grimes added that "we're happy to help a local charity, and a great cause, with, what promises to be a fiercely contested match. The bar will be open for food and drink and we'll have the FA Cup Final on the big screen afterwards as well."
